What is a Wheat Beer?
Most beers are brewed predominantly with malted barley. However, the wheat beer is a little different. Wheat beers are typically top-fermented and always feature a much more significant proportion of wheat in comparison to the barley used. This unique ratio results in a noticeably lighter taste and colour.

Took The Midnight Grain is a dark, highly roasted stout brewed with copious amounts of midnight wheat. Midnight wheat is a unique choice for a stout that can be roasted quite darkly without creating that acidic taste craft beer nerds know as “astringency”.
